Главная страница
Библиотека (скачать книги)
Скачать софт
Введение в программирование
Стандарты для C++
Уроки по C#
Уроки по Python
HTML
Веб-дизайн
Ассемблер в среде Windows
ActiveX
Javascript
Общее о Линукс
Линукс - подробно
Линукс - новое
Delphi
Паскаль для начинающих
Турбопаскаль
Новости
Партнеры
Наши предложения
Архив новостей





М Сортировать задания по размеру памяти, постоянно выделенной под каждое из них.
N Сортировать задания по численным идентификаторам
процессов.

top

Р Сортировать процессы по использованию процессорных ресурсов (режим по умолчанию).
S Управление режимом накопления (см. параметр —S).
Т Сортировать процессы по времени/суммарному времени выполнения.
W Записать текущие настройки в файл ~/.toprc. Это предпочтительный способ записи настроек top.

 

touch

touch [options] files
Обновить время доступа и изменения для указанных файлов (/?Zes)TeKyniHM значением. С помощью touch можно заставить команды работать с файлами определенным образом. В частности, работа make или find может зависеть от времени доступа и изменения файла. Если файл не существует, touch создает его, при этом размер файла равен нулю.
Параметры
—а, —time=atime, —time=access, —time=use
Обновить только время доступа к файлу.
-с, —no-create
Не создавать несуществующие файлы.
-dtime, —date time
Заменить текущее значение времени на указанное (time). Время может задаваться в различных форматах и содержать названия месяцев, информацию о часовых поясах, строки a.m. и p.m. и т. д.
—m, —time=mtime, —time=modify
Обновить только время изменения файла.
-Tfile, —reference file
Изменить информацию о времени на информацию для файла file.
-t time
Использовать указанное время вместо текущего. Аргумент должен иметь формат [[cc]yy]mmddhhmm[.ss],yKa-зывая месяц, дату, часы, минуты, при необходимости век, год, а также секунды.
—help
Вывести справку по использованию программы. —version
Вывести информацию о номере версии программы.

tr [options] [stringl [string2]]
tr

Преобразование символов - стандартный ввод копируется

на стандартный вывод после замены символов строки

stringl на символы строки string2umi удаления символов из

stringl.

Параметры

—с, —complement

Дополнить символы строки stringl с учетом ASCII-диапа-

зона 001-377.

-d, —delete

Удалить символы строки stringl из вывода.

—s, —squeeze-repeats

Сократить последовательности повторяющихся символов

в строке stringl до одного символа.

—t, —truncate-setl

Перед преобразованием произвести усечение stringl до

длиныstring2.

—help

Отобразить справку и завершить работу.

—version

Вывести информацию о версии программы и завершить

работу.

Специальные символы

Квадратные скобки [ ] необходимо указывать, если они есть

в описании.

\а (сигнал)

\Ь ЛН (забой)

\f ~L (новая страница)

\п М (новая строка)

\г ЛМ(возврат каретки)

\t I (табуляция)

\v "К (вертикальная табуляция)

\ппп

Символ с восьмеричным ASCII-кодом ппп.

\\ Символ «\».

tr
charl-char2


Все символы диапазона charl-char2. Если charl не пред-


шествует char2 в наборе символов, это вызывает ошибку.


[charl-char2]


То же, что и charl-char2, если конструкция [chart-


сЛаг2]используется в обеих строках.


[char*]


Буквальное включение содержимого скобок. Количество


вхождений символа расширяется до длины строки



stringl.


[char*number]


Буквальное включение содержимого скобок. Количество


вхождений символа расширяется до указанного. Напри-


мер, [х*4] — это хххх.


[¦.class:]


Буквальное включение содержимого скобок. Расширение


до полного набора символов указанного класса.


alnum Буквы и цифры.


alpha Буквы.


blank Пробелы.


cntrl Управляющие символы.


digit Цифры.


graph Все отображаемые символы кроме пробела.


lower Символы нижнего регистра.


print Все отображаемые символы.


punct Символы пунктуации.


space Пробелы и символы табуляции (горизонтальной


или вертикальной).


upper Символы верхнего регистра.


xdigit Шестнадцатеричные цифры.


[=char=]


Класс символов, к которому принадлежит символ char.


Примеры


В содержимом файла изменить символы верхнего регистра


на символы нижнего:


cat file | tr '[A-Z]' '[a-z]'

 

Преобразовать пробелы в символы новой строки (код ASCII = 012):
tr ' 1 '\012' < file
Удалить пустые строки из файла file и сохранить результат в файле new.file (можно также использовать 011, чтобы заменить последовательные табуляторы одним):

tr

cat file | tr -s

.\012" > new.file

Удалить двоеточия из файла file; результат сохранить в файле new.file:
tr -d : < file > new.file

traceroute [options] host [packetsize]
Команда TCP/IP. Отслеживание маршрута пакетов, посыла-
емых определенному узлу сети (host). Для выполнения по-
ставленной задачи traceroute отправляет пробные UDP-na-
кеты с небольшим временем жизни TTL (time-to-live), а за-
тем ожидает получения (время
истекло) от шлюза, host может задаваться именем конечного
узла или IP-адресом. Аргумент packet size определяет размер
посылаемых пробных пакетов в байтах. По умолчанию раз-
мер равен 38.
Параметры
Отключение отладки уровня сокета (socket).
-g addr
Включение параметра IP LSRR (Loose Source Record Route) в дополнение к проверке по TTL. Позволяет выяснить, по какому маршруту идут пакеты на IP-адрес addr от конечного узла.
-1 Включать значение time-to-live для каждого из полученных пакетов.
-m maxjttl
Установить максимальное время жизни исходящих па-
кетов в транзитных участков (hops). По умолча-
нию равно 30.
Показать численные, а не буквенные адреса узлов на
транзитных участках. Полезно при нерабочем сервере доменных имен.

traceroute

traceroute
-p port



   
 

Библиотека программиста. 2009.
Администратор: admin@programmer-lib.ru